Ida Augusta, daughter of Gustav A. and Wilhelmina Anna (Fischer) Ress, was born September 22, 1900, on a farm in Lincoln Township, Audubon County, Iowa. She was baptized on October 14, 1900, into the Lutheran Faith.

Ida attended country school near her home until 1913 when the family moved to a farm in the Manilla area and she started attending the Manilla schools. She also attended Lutheran School in Manning making her home with her Grandpa and Grandma Fred Fischer through the school week. Following her confirmation on March 28, 1915, she returned home and helped with the work there.

On January 30, 1929, Ida was united in marriage with Herman Jochimsen. They farmed near Manilla for many years and then retired to their new home in Manning. They raised four children. Ida was a life long member of the Lutheran Church. Ida was interested in tatting, quilting and crocheting. She belonged to several card clubs.

Herman died in 1991 and Ida continued to live in their home until she had a fall in January of 1998. On February 1, 1998, she became a resident of the Manning Plaza Nursing Home. She died at the Manning Regional Healthcare Center on Tuesday, April 18, 2000, at the age of 99 years, 6 months and 26 days.
